Developing a GPS tracking system for livestock and wildlife focused on supporting community resource management and conservation. The project integrated GPS-enabled devices with a cloud-based platform for real-time monitoring of animal movements. Alerts notify users if animals leave designated zones, preventing loss, theft, or human-wildlife conflicts.

The system also provides analytics on movement patterns, helping communities optimize grazing areas, manage livestock efficiently, and support wildlife conservation.
